High initial investment: Some of Delaval's advanced solutions, such as robotic milking systems, can come with a high initial investment cost, which may not be affordable for all farmers. Maintenance and repair costs: While Delaval's solutions are designed to be durable and reliable, there may be maintenance and repair costs associated with using them over time, which can add to the overall cost of ownership. Dependence on technology: Some critics argue that Delaval's solutions, particularly its robotic milking systems, may lead to a dependence on technology and a reduction in the skills and knowledge required for traditional dairy farming practices. Limited customization: Delaval's solutions may not be customizable to fit the specific needs of every dairy farm, which may limit their usefulness for some farmers. Competition: Delaval operates in a competitive market, with other companies offering similar solutions for dairy farming. This may make it challenging for Delaval to stand out and attract new customers.
